You will be a Structural Analyst for the Lockheed Martin Missiles and Fire Control (MFC) team. Our team is responsible for performing structural and dynamics analysis for our missile and launch systems, supporting initial and detail designs of advanced hardware from concept through the full product life cycle. What You Will Be Doing As a structural analyst, you will be responsible for applying your expertise in dynamic and structural analysis to drive the development of new aerospace products. You will work collaboratively with cross-functional teams to plan, develop, and test innovative solutions. Your responsibilities will include: Supporting conceptual and detailed design of advanced hardware through the full product life cycle via dynamics and structural analysis Collaborating with individuals from complementary disciplines within Engineering, Manufacturing, and Sub-Contracts organizations Applying research to the planning, development, and testing of new aerospace and related products Working with little direction to develop advanced technical principles, techniques, and concepts Being proficient in dynamic/structural analysis, finite element analysis, structural/vibration testing, and test correlation Utilizing related application software such as ANSA, Nastran, Abaqus, NX, FEMAP, Patran, and HyperMesh Why Join Us Do you want to be part of a company culture that empowers employees to think big, lead with a growth mindset, and make the impossible a reality? Basic Qualifications Basic Qualifications : -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ering or similar, from an accredited university, with 3+ years of industry experience performing structural analysis - Final Secret clearance - Experience with NX /NASTRAN finite element modeling - Ability to apply new and advanced analytical techniques necessary to perform structural analysis - Knowledge of and applicable experience with spacecraft or aircraft structural analysis methods, including classical hand calculations, experience with mechanical joints - Ability to work in a collaborative and highly integrated team environment - Ability and desire to assume ownership of tasks and drive to closure quickly and efficiently Desired skills - Masters degree in Structural Dynamics or similar, from an accredited university, with 3+ years of aerospace industry experience - Experience working missile and launch systems for DoD customers - Experience performing static and dynamic analyses to include inertial, pressure, vibration, and shock loading - Experience defining and supporting static, vibration, acoustic, modal and shock testing and model correlation - Experience supporting both hardware development and production environments - Experience with the structural requirements of MIL-M-8856 and MIL-STD-810 Lockheed Martin is an equal opportunity employer.
